gnucash stable: Multiple changes pushed

John Ralls jralls at code.gnucash.org
Sat May 27 10:12:27 EDT 2023


Updated	 via  https://github.com/Gnucash/gnucash/commit/b56eff68 (commit)
	 via  https://github.com/Gnucash/gnucash/commit/dd5be317 (commit)
	 via  https://github.com/Gnucash/gnucash/commit/1b9bd075 (commit)
	 via  https://github.com/Gnucash/gnucash/commit/aca60210 (commit)
	 via  https://github.com/Gnucash/gnucash/commit/945f63bd (commit)
	 via  https://github.com/Gnucash/gnucash/commit/2213e63e (commit)
	 via  https://github.com/Gnucash/gnucash/commit/39a1bfd1 (commit)
	 via  https://github.com/Gnucash/gnucash/commit/fea6405f (commit)
	 via  https://github.com/Gnucash/gnucash/commit/80f370f0 (commit)
	 via  https://github.com/Gnucash/gnucash/commit/546a91a5 (commit)
	 via  https://github.com/Gnucash/gnucash/commit/b5497dc4 (commit)
	 via  https://github.com/Gnucash/gnucash/commit/52a9af21 (commit)
	 via  https://github.com/Gnucash/gnucash/commit/02f61c6d (commit)
	 via  https://github.com/Gnucash/gnucash/commit/3db83b7a (commit)
	 via  https://github.com/Gnucash/gnucash/commit/5d98cc4c (commit)
	 via  https://github.com/Gnucash/gnucash/commit/965fe59a (commit)
	 via  https://github.com/Gnucash/gnucash/commit/b621b5cd (commit)
	 via  https://github.com/Gnucash/gnucash/commit/d4649bc6 (commit)
	 via  https://github.com/Gnucash/gnucash/commit/fd56cb6b (commit)
	 via  https://github.com/Gnucash/gnucash/commit/c632164d (commit)
	 via  https://github.com/Gnucash/gnucash/commit/faba15a4 (commit)
	 via  https://github.com/Gnucash/gnucash/commit/b669d272 (commit)
	 via  https://github.com/Gnucash/gnucash/commit/9a8f54a2 (commit)
	 via  https://github.com/Gnucash/gnucash/commit/b3e13d46 (commit)
	 via  https://github.com/Gnucash/gnucash/commit/7c7ec317 (commit)
	 via  https://github.com/Gnucash/gnucash/commit/23e4d0e1 (commit)
	 via  https://github.com/Gnucash/gnucash/commit/5d39d83a (commit)
	 via  https://github.com/Gnucash/gnucash/commit/5d955654 (commit)
	 via  https://github.com/Gnucash/gnucash/commit/167c55e5 (commit)
	 via  https://github.com/Gnucash/gnucash/commit/8e36a645 (commit)
	 via  https://github.com/Gnucash/gnucash/commit/cce0ccff (commit)
	from  https://github.com/Gnucash/gnucash/commit/6111184c (commit)



commit b56eff6821b20371fbdac002139a83ef21422a51
Merge: dd5be317d8 cce0ccff7b
Author: John Ralls <jralls at ceridwen.us>
Date:   Sat May 27 10:10:44 2023 -0400

    Merge Richard Cohen's 'fix-show-log-window' into stable.

commit dd5be317d8f0da0d6ca63fe01a143864214f4b77
Merge: 1b9bd0752b 945f63bd4d
Author: John Ralls <jralls at ceridwen.us>
Date:   Sat May 27 10:09:05 2023 -0400

    Merge Richard Cohen's 'define-type' into stable.

commit 1b9bd0752b2ae759fce28468f5d62d9d5140331f
Merge: 6111184c73 aca602103e
Author: John Ralls <jralls at ceridwen.us>
Date:   Sat May 27 10:06:42 2023 -0400

    Merge Simon Arlott's 'bug-798796' into stable.

commit aca602103e113c6e0d33ad30e8d11a0926ed5eba
Author: Simon Arlott <sa.me.uk>
Date:   Fri May 26 19:16:46 2023 +0100

    Bug 798796 - Account list incomplete in report options
    
    Allow stock/fund accounts that are descendants of Bank accounts to be
    selected for the Advanced Portfolio, Investment Lots and Investment
    Portfolio reports.

commit 945f63bd4df90b0034a3132964549a17ebbbf4e8
Author: Richard Cohen <richard at daijobu.co.uk>
Date:   Thu May 4 17:32:54 2023 +0100

    Refactor: DEFINE_TYPE GnucashSheet < GtkLayout

commit 2213e63e3041cc4581b131e323c1c9ad10fcf010
Author: Richard Cohen <richard at daijobu.co.uk>
Date:   Thu May 4 17:32:43 2023 +0100

    Refactor: DEFINE_TYPE GnucashRegister < GtkGrid

commit 39a1bfd10da528887555d3f7d2ae8d654207a8e6
Author: Richard Cohen <richard at daijobu.co.uk>
Date:   Thu May 4 17:32:37 2023 +0100

    Refactor: DEFINE_TYPE GncItemList < GtkEventBox

commit fea6405f789c38f4ed5348747cea1b40c165fa54
Author: Richard Cohen <richard at daijobu.co.uk>
Date:   Thu May 4 17:32:31 2023 +0100

    Refactor: DEFINE_TYPE GncItemEditTb < GtkToggleButton

commit 80f370f0d29cc11ea44e5582bb7618314349e284
Author: Richard Cohen <richard at daijobu.co.uk>
Date:   Fri May 5 13:36:01 2023 +0100

    Refactor: DEFINE_TYPE GncItemEdit < GtkBox

commit 546a91a5753a9de848c59447d1c9f6e87bdddd68
Author: Richard Cohen <richard at daijobu.co.uk>
Date:   Thu May 4 17:32:24 2023 +0100

    Refactor: DEFINE_TYPE GncHeader < GtkLayout

commit b5497dc45b412e97defa9cd50b747832ae867f08
Author: Richard Cohen <richard at daijobu.co.uk>
Date:   Mon Apr 24 12:43:19 2023 +0100

    Refactor: DEFINE_TYPE GncDatePicker < GtkBox

commit 52a9af217784894347ab76e70f04e05889cdfc18
Author: Richard Cohen <richard at daijobu.co.uk>
Date:   Thu May 4 18:08:57 2023 +0100

    Refactor: DEFINE_TYPE GnucashCursor < GObject

commit 02f61c6d76bad32bd7231cb7841445c721b4bd54
Author: Richard Cohen <richard at daijobu.co.uk>
Date:   Thu May 4 17:55:02 2023 +0100

    Refactor: DEFINE_TYPE GNCReconcileView < GNCQueryView

commit 3db83b7a2cd2188662c9ca6c8a963f036a3fbc27
Author: Richard Cohen <richard at daijobu.co.uk>
Date:   Thu May 11 16:23:21 2023 +0100

    Refactor: DEFINE_TYPE GNCSplitReg < GtkBox

commit 5d98cc4c1db47c881e0bfcc3e5e77223d0ee6aea
Author: Richard Cohen <richard at daijobu.co.uk>
Date:   Thu May 4 17:32:05 2023 +0100

    Refactor: DEFINE_TYPE GncSxSlrTreeModelAdapter < GObject

commit 965fe59a46e8e5470527c664795a627d963c1cd3
Author: Richard Cohen <richard at daijobu.co.uk>
Date:   Thu May 4 17:31:50 2023 +0100

    Refactor: DEFINE_TYPE GncSxListTreeModelAdapter < GObject

commit b621b5cd99ec1224ceb2bcde711f187124d147ea
Author: Richard Cohen <richard at daijobu.co.uk>
Date:   Mon May 22 10:37:36 2023 +0100

    Refactor: DEFINE_TYPE GncSxInstanceDenseCalAdapter < GObject

commit d4649bc67f85e53f5519cd38565e89260010a2b4
Author: Richard Cohen <richard at daijobu.co.uk>
Date:   Wed May 24 10:30:32 2023 +0100

    Refactor: DEFINE_TYPE GncRecurrenceComp < GtkScrolledWindow

commit fd56cb6b7867b2e7dcd67d054cfcd5d78ee381a6
Author: Richard Cohen <richard at daijobu.co.uk>
Date:   Mon May 22 10:33:01 2023 +0100

    Refactor: DEFINE_TYPE GncRecurrence < GtkBox

commit c632164d38f782be169eddeaaff41d2bc62ac1b3
Author: Richard Cohen <richard at daijobu.co.uk>
Date:   Thu May 4 17:31:37 2023 +0100

    Refactor: DEFINE_TYPE GNCGeneralSelect < GtkBox
    
    - don't need checks for parent dispose & finalize

commit faba15a4c7fffa5f876f45b9ec338d2fb29ed106
Author: Richard Cohen <richard at daijobu.co.uk>
Date:   Mon May 22 10:35:42 2023 +0100

    Refactor: DEFINE_TYPE GncFrequency < GtkBox
    
    - also
     - make gnc_frequency_init() private
     - rename gnc_frequency_class_destroy() to gnc_frequency_destroy()

commit b669d2722bef061c2e617b6e1b548dd1de3f6de2
Author: Richard Cohen <richard at daijobu.co.uk>
Date:   Fri May 26 11:25:48 2023 +0100

    Refactor: DEFINE_TYPE GncDenseCalStore < GObject

commit 9a8f54a2e14de4c5773d527ce0240d3daaab99d1
Author: Richard Cohen <richard at daijobu.co.uk>
Date:   Mon May 22 10:36:11 2023 +0100

    Refactor: DEFINE_TYPE GncDenseCal < GtkBox

commit b3e13d46de0e4843006882a712618a12e8328b15
Author: Richard Cohen <richard at daijobu.co.uk>
Date:   Mon May 22 10:30:35 2023 +0100

    Refactor: DEFINE_TYPE GNCDateEdit < GtkBox

commit 7c7ec317f8ebfab64afb5bb2f66d8d6aca17cbab
Author: Richard Cohen <richard at daijobu.co.uk>
Date:   Thu May 4 17:31:12 2023 +0100

    Refactor: DEFINE_TYPE GncPopupEntry < GtkEventBox

commit 23e4d0e1a1057351d2c26fcb19c2ab18ed87a87b
Author: Richard Cohen <richard at daijobu.co.uk>
Date:   Thu May 4 18:48:51 2023 +0100

    Refactor: DEFINE_TYPE GncCellRendererPopup < GtkCellRendererText

commit 5d39d83a87b6619b274e9eb386b3dd6fab64b159
Author: Richard Cohen <richard at daijobu.co.uk>
Date:   Fri May 5 13:40:40 2023 +0100

    Refactor: DEFINE_TYPE GncCellRendererDate < GncCellRendererPopup

commit 5d955654bc106e739d43c6a913a8ab499ee61bbc
Author: Richard Cohen <richard at daijobu.co.uk>
Date:   Mon May 22 10:40:01 2023 +0100

    Refactor: DEFINE_TYPE GncSxInstanceModel < GObject

commit 167c55e5068839da9a46e791a45ed010acb331de
Author: Richard Cohen <richard at daijobu.co.uk>
Date:   Sat May 20 17:25:30 2023 +0100

    Refactor: DEFINE_TYPE GOOptionMenu < GtkButton

commit 8e36a64506018f9b61cc3e7bf8836db26b435baa
Author: Richard Cohen <richard at daijobu.co.uk>
Date:   Wed May 3 14:21:14 2023 +0100

    Refactor: DEFINE_TYPE GOCharmapSel < GtkBox

commit cce0ccff7b8732feca9cef2750ca680614115409
Author: Richard Cohen <richard at daijobu.co.uk>
Date:   Mon May 22 10:45:55 2023 +0100

    BUGFIX: Actions > Online Actions > Show log Window does not open ...
    
    ... when it is first clicked



Summary of changes:
 borrowed/goffice/go-charmap-sel.c                  | 37 ++---------
 borrowed/goffice/go-optionmenu.c                   | 28 +--------
 gnucash/gnome-utils/gnc-cell-renderer-date.c       | 49 +++------------
 .../gnome-utils/gnc-cell-renderer-popup-entry.c    | 48 +--------------
 gnucash/gnome-utils/gnc-cell-renderer-popup.c      | 41 ++----------
 gnucash/gnome-utils/gnc-date-edit.c                | 53 ++--------------
 gnucash/gnome-utils/gnc-dense-cal-store.c          | 51 ++++-----------
 gnucash/gnome-utils/gnc-dense-cal.c                | 41 +-----------
 gnucash/gnome-utils/gnc-frequency.c                | 44 ++-----------
 gnucash/gnome-utils/gnc-frequency.h                |  2 -
 gnucash/gnome-utils/gnc-general-select.c           | 51 ++-------------
 gnucash/gnome-utils/gnc-recurrence.c               | 58 +----------------
 .../gnc-sx-instance-dense-cal-adapter.c            | 52 +++-------------
 .../gnome-utils/gnc-sx-list-tree-model-adapter.c   | 68 +++-----------------
 gnucash/gnome/dialog-sx-since-last-run.c           | 58 +++--------------
 gnucash/gnome/gnc-split-reg.c                      | 30 +--------
 gnucash/gnome/reconcile-view.c                     | 36 +----------
 gnucash/import-export/aqb/gnc-gwen-gui.c           |  5 +-
 gnucash/register/register-gnome/gnucash-cursor.c   | 43 +++----------
 .../register/register-gnome/gnucash-date-picker.c  | 35 +----------
 gnucash/register/register-gnome/gnucash-header.c   | 42 ++-----------
 .../register/register-gnome/gnucash-item-edit.c    | 72 ++--------------------
 .../register/register-gnome/gnucash-item-list.c    | 35 +----------
 gnucash/register/register-gnome/gnucash-register.c | 36 +----------
 gnucash/register/register-gnome/gnucash-sheet.c    | 51 +++------------
 .../report/reports/standard/advanced-portfolio.scm |  2 +-
 .../report/reports/standard/investment-lots.scm    |  2 +-
 gnucash/report/reports/standard/portfolio.scm      |  2 +-
 libgnucash/app-utils/gnc-sx-instance-model.c       | 42 ++-----------
 29 files changed, 133 insertions(+), 981 deletions(-)



More information about the gnucash-patches mailing list